Pakistan: 6 Militants Targeting Americans Arrested
LAHORE, Pakistan (AP) ―

Police say six suspected Taliban militants with a suicide vest and hand grenades have been arrested while heading to a five-star hotel in Pakistan's cultural capital intending to kill Americans.
Police official Zulfikar Hameed says authorities seized the six, one wearing a vest filled with explosives, on the outskirts of the eastern city of Lahore on Monday.
Hameed says police also seized 26 hand grenades and five detonators. The group included a 14-year-old boy and a prayer leader from a mosque in Pakistan's Khyber tribal area.
Hameed says the militants planned to attack the Pearl Continental Lahore hotel but did not know for certain if any Americans are staying there.
